The Russian Tzar House is a must visit.
The Russian Tzar House is a must visit. It is the oldest house in Netherlands, preserved in very good conditions. You will learn a lot. The Zaan Museum also. The Zaanse Schans it is for one whole day or two days visit. A lot of museums. It is very nice. And if it is good wind you are going to smell only chocolate in the air. The bakery just in front of the bridge is having the most delicious patisserie. The restaurants around have great food, nice personnel.

14 minutes north by Sprinter train to Schanse Windmills and...
14 minutes north by Sprinter train to Schanse Windmills and about the same south to AMS Centraal the town boasts several good and reasonable nable restaurants, four cafes an two good bakeries. A Primark is close to the station and Saturday morning boasts a little food and produce market in the square.
